Mechanism of Action
This ferment filtrate acts as a skin conditioning agent, supporting the skin's overall health and appearance. While specific mechanistic details for this exact ingredient are not extensively documented, related ferment extracts are known to function as humectants, suggesting a potential to draw and bind water in the stratum corneum, thereby enhancing skin hydration.

Safety Profile
The Cosmetic Ingredient Review (CIR) Expert Panel has not specifically reviewed Pantoea Vagans Ferment Extract Filtrate. Previous CIR assessments of 'Yeast-Derived Ingredients' are not directly applicable as *Pantoea vagans* is a bacterium. There is no specific SCCS opinion available for this ingredient. Topical probiotics, in general, are recognized for moisturizing and anti-inflammatory benefits in skincare, though they lack formal FDA approval at this time.

Verdict
Pantoea Vagans Ferment Extract Filtrate functions as a skin conditioning agent with potential humectant benefits, yet comprehensive data regarding its clinical efficacy and specific safety profile remain insufficient for a definitive rating.
